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blazed Luzon Chrotomys | Buff-rumped Thornbill |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(प्राणी) | Animalia (प्राणी)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(रज्जुकी) | Chordata (रज्जुकी) |
| Class | Mammalia (स्तनधारी) | Aves (पक्षी) |
| Order | Rodentia (कृंतक) | Passeriformes (पासरीफ़ोर्मीज़) |
| Family | Muridae (Mice & Rats) | Acanthizidae |
| Genus | Chrotomys | Acanthiza |
| Species | Chrotomys silaceus | Acanthiza reguloides |
Evolutionary Relationship
Blazed Luzon Chrotomys and Buff-rumped Thornbill share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(रज्जुकी)
